L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) – Lincoln police arrested a woman after she assaulted officers by kicking them, causing minor injuries.

On Tuesday, Lincoln police recieved a call to a residence near the 3400 block of C Street on a check welfare.

Officers contacted a woman who was exiting a backyard, the woman matched the caller’s description.

The 26-year-old resident told police the woman had tried to enter her home and had begun to rummage through her detached garage.

Officers tried to take the woman into custody, she began to kick them in their torso, legs and back. After the struggle, officers successfuly took the woman into custody.

LPD arrested 36-year-old Monica Hinn for 2 counts of assault on a police officer, resisting arrest and criminal trespassing.
